A white-fleshed sea fish found in European waters, John Dory (also known as St Peter's fish), is an odd-looking creature with an oval, flat body and a large, spiny head. They live near the seabed, living in depths from 5 metres (15 ft) to 360 metres (1200 ft). It isn't a fish targeted by fishermen, and is usually caught as a bycatch. Enjoy the best of both worlds. Avoid John Dory during their breeding season from June to August - for ethical purposes, and because the taste and texture of John Dory is not at its best during its breeding season. John Dory are benthopelagic coastal fish, found on the coasts of Africa, South East Asia, New Zealand, Australia, the coasts of Japan, and on the coasts of Europe. It is an unusual fish - although technically a round fish, its bone structure is more akin to a flat fish.
